Business Development Graduate - Summer 2025'
3 months ago
Newcastle upon Tyne
Keyence is a world leader in Sensors, Safety, Vision, Measurement and Microscopes. Founded in Japan ... You will be meeting and demonstrating our products to technicians, engineers, managers and ...